FDA Approves Drug to Treat Infants and Children with HIV

June 12, 2020

Via: BioSpace

Today,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ration approved Tivicay (dolutegravir) tablets and Tivicay PD (dolutegravir) tablets for suspension to treat HIV-1 infection in pediatric patients at least four weeks old and weighing at least 3 kg (6.61 pounds) in combination with other antiretroviral treatments.

“For babies and young children with HIV, getting treatment early is very important. HIV can progress more quickly in children than adults,” said Debra Birnkrant, M.D., director of the Division of Antivirals in FDA’s Center for Drug Evaluation and Research.
